use the text to compare and contrast cajun cuisine and creole cuisine. thanks to cajun and creole cuisines, no other state in america has such distinctive food as louisiana does. the word cajun describes french settlers who were forced out of canada and settled in south louisiana. in their new rural surroundings, these poor settlers developed their own type of food. creole cuisine is different from cajun in that it reflects a blend of many cultures. african, caribbean, native american, spanish, and italian influences can all be found in creole food. unlike cajun cuisine, creole cuisine was born in the kitchens of new orleanss upper class, who had access to ingredients like tomatoes, butter, and oysters. for this reason, creole cuisine tends to have more variety. is found in louisiana cajun cuisine creole cuisine reflects a wide mix of cultures developed in the kitchens of the wealthy
- "Thanks to Cajun and Creole cuisines, no other state in America has such distinctive food as Louisiana does." So both are found in Louisiana.
- "Creole cuisine is different from Cajun in that it reflects a blend of many cultures." So only Creole reflects a wide - mix of cultures.
- "Unlike Cajun cuisine, Creole cuisine was born in the kitchens of New Orleans's upper class..." So only Creole developed in the kitchens of the wealthy.
